Missouri man injured after pickup strikes a tree

Posted Jan 28, 2022 11:17 PM

DAVIESS COUNTY —A Missouri man was injured in an accident just after 9a.m. Friday in Daviess County.

The Missouri State Highway Patrol reported a 2013 Ford F 250 driven by Jeremy A. Wells, 44, Weatherby, was eastbound on U.S. 69 five miles south of Pattonsburg.

The driver failed to stop at the intersection at Route E. The pickup traveled across U.S. 69 and struck a tree.

Daviess County ambulance transported Wells to Cameron Regional Medical Center. He was not wearing a seat belt, according to the MSHP.
